Organizations like the National Center for Transgender Equality and grassroots support networks provide essential hubs for advocacy and community-building.

Despite their foundational contributions, the transgender community has frequently faced internal friction within LGBTQ culture. For instance, at the 1973 Pride parade, Sylvia Rivera was famously booed while attempting to address the crowd, highlighting a historical struggle for trans visibility even within "safe" spaces. LGBTQ+ culture has created and reclaimed language to articulate experience. For trans people, this includes terms like "egg" (a trans person who hasn't realized their identity yet), "transfeminine" / "transmasculine" , and the use of neopronouns (e.g., ze/zir, they/them).
